University of Trieste
Bachelor of Primary Education Sciences
- Trieste, Italy
Bachelor
On-Campus
English
The single-cycle degree in Primary Education Sciences is the only qualification recognized as qualifying for teaching, both for nursery schools and for primary schools. According to Ministerial Decree 249/2010, the Study Course includes a single five-year educational path, consisting of classroom teaching activities, laboratories integrated with the teachings and 600 hours of internship in local schools, thus guaranteeing integration between the training activities basic (oriented towards the development of skills transversal to the profession: psychological, linked to teaching methodologies and communication), the characterizing training activities, which revolve around disciplinary knowledge and their teaching (characterizing training activities of area 1) and the training activities characterizing inclusion (Training activities characterizing area 2).
